nature bounty

I really love my little piece on earth... I 've planted many trees plus the ones already here part of a native forest now protected by law.  I have avocados, oranges, tangerines, lemons ( 2 different kinds), acerola --a little fruit cherry like with a vit C content higher than oranges or lemons, delicious to eat like cherries or to make juice usually it is combined with orange or such-- I've just got some grape vines which are going to be planted shortly, sugar cane, pomegranate, jabuticaba -- a little fruit that grows on the bark of the tree which I have already posted here, peach, banana and mulberry... I love to walk around the garden eating from the trees.   I have two big banana bunches on the trees and another just filling up...they will soon be ready to be cut from the trees.

Here you can see the acerola fruit and tree... the tree is 4 years old and this year it really filled up and we can't keep up with it.  It's such a pretty little fruit, and when it is ripe on the tree it's a most beautiful red !
